How to Earn a Driver’s License in WI

Automobile License

If you wish to drive in Wisconsin, it is mandatory for you to obtain a driver’s license first. This state offers the Graduated Licensing Program to help new drivers start their driver’s training.

The Graduated Licensing Program encompasses three stages:

  • Instructional permit. You are allowed to qualify once you are 15 years and six months old. Make sure to present identification docs and SSN and get your parent’s permission. Prior to applying, you must enroll a driver training course, which then enables you to complete traffic signs exam and WI written permit test. Also, you will be asked to undergo a vision screening and pay a $35 fee;
  • Provisional driver’s license. You are allowed to apply when you reached 16 and held your learner’s permit for six months. Again, you will be obliged to provide your identification documents and SSN. You will also have to present a driving log with thirty hours of practiced driving including ten hours of driving after dark. After passing Wisconsin DMV driving road test and paying a $28 fee, you will be given a provisional license;
  • Regular license. Consider applying once you turn 18 and have kept your provisional license for two years. You will be asked to undergo a vision screening and pay a $28 fee.

Motorcycle License

Drivers younger than 18 who wish to gain a motorcycle license in Wisconsin are obliged to get a learner’s permit first. The typical requirements are:

  • reach 16 years of age;
  • present a parent’s approval;
  • submit a certificate confirming a driver training course completion;
  • join the Motorcycle Safety Foundation program;
  • pay a $32 fee.

Upon obtaining a learner’s permit which is active for six months, you can qualify for a Class M license. Pass a driving test and pay an appropriate fee to get your WI motorcycle license issued.

Commercial Driver’s License

There are two major requirements you need to meet prior to applying for a commercial driver’s license in Wisconsin:

  • be 18 years old;
  • hold a non-commercial driver’s license;
  • present proofs of US citizenship and residency.

The first thing to do is to qualify for a commercial learner’s permit. You will need to:

  • bring in proofs of US citizenship and residency;
  • undergo a medical check;
  • provide your driver’s license;
  • pass a written exam;
  • pay a $30 fee.

As soon as you have obtained your commercial learner’s permit, you need to wait 14 days to take your driving test. Before that, you will be asked to undergo a vehicle examination. Make sure to take your commercial learner’s permit to your driving exam.

Your commercial driver’s license is valid for eight years. Once it expires, you will have to go through this process again.
